dht: Do opendir selectively in gf_defrag_process_dir
Currently opendir is done from the cluster view. Hence, even if one opendir is successful, the opendir operation as a whole is considered successful. But since in gf_defrag_get_entry we fetch entries selectively from local_subvols, we need to opendir individually on those local subvols and keep track of fds separately. Otherwise it is possible that opendir failed on one of the subvol and we wind readdirp call on the fd to the corresponding subvol, which will ultimately result in EINVAL error. fixes: #1218 Change-Id: I50dd88b9597852a15579f4ee325918979417f570 Signed-off-by: Susant Palai <spalai@redhat.com>
